Toal, Gregory
 
  
Gregory Toal studied in the NCAD,Kildare Street,Dublin and The College of Marketing and Design, Parnell Square Dublin in the 1980's . He was greatly influenced by Flora Mitchell , Liam Martin and Edward Hopper . He developed an individual style in pen and watercolour while studying at NCAD, Kildare Street, Dublin. His latest works are acrylic interpretative landscapes, beaches and rural scenes, depicted in warm expressive colours. Viewers are absorbed into the various moods keenly expressed in these works. 

Gregory has been invited to exhibit in the Florence Biennale 2003 & 2005/7, the Arad Biennale May 2005, Romania, and the Cill Rialaigh Artists Project Ireland. Gregory has again been invited to exhibit at the Florence Biennale in 2013.
